学习java——day02

学习内容:

1.注释

2.标识符

3.关键词

4.字符集合

5.变量

6.数据类型


学习产出:

一、注释

1.1什么是注释

注释就是解释说明的文字,我们编写程序不能只有程序没有说明文档,注释就是说明文档,帮助我们更好的理解程序。

1.2注释的分类

注释名称注释编写方式注意事项
单行注释//注释内容只能注释当前行
多行注释/* 注释内容 */注释多行信息
文档型注释/** 注释内容 */注释多行信息,生成帮助文档

1.3生成帮助文档API

 先编写一个程序,在程序中使用文档注释

 在Dos窗口中输入命令:

javadoc  -d  “生成的路径”  -windowtitle  “浏览器的标题”  -author[保证文档型注释中包含] -
version *.java文件的文件名

 

 二、标识符

2.1什么是标识符

标识符:标注、识别的符号。用来给java中类、接口、变量、常量等起名

2.2命名规则和命名标准

  1. 以字母、_ 、 $ 开头 ,后跟字母、_ 、 $ 、 数字
  2. 不能是java中的关键字
  3. Java中严格区分大小写
  4. Java中起名尽量做到见名知意
  5. 驼峰原则:每个单词的首字母大写
    public class JavaDocAnnounce{
    	
    }

    注:Java中采用的字符集和时 Unicode ,所以理论上Java中所说的 字母 可以使任意国家的任意字符。但是前提是你的自己算计支持。也就也为这起名可以使用中文。但是不推荐使用。

三、关键词

Java中已经标注了其含义以及用法的,我们不能再使用

修饰符public  private protected  static...
流程控制if else for switch while do try catch finally break continue return...
基本数据类型int byte short char long double float boolean true false
类和类之间的关系import package extends implements throw throws...
保留字goto cast null true false

四、字符集合

  • 字符集合解决的问题就是为了让计算机能够正确的读取以及写入我们常用的字符
  • Java采用的是Unicode字库,包含了所有国家的常用字符
  • 针对Unicode字库中的字符,最常用的字符集合是UTF-8
  • 不同的字符集合,存储的数据的位置可能不同,导致乱码等问题

  乱码出现的原因就是字符集合不一致,所以只需要保证字符集合一致就可以防止出现乱码

五、变量

5.1 什么是变量

在程序运行期间其值可以发生改变的内容。在Java中我们编写程序通常需要一些容器来存储我们的数据以用来在编写中使用。

5.2 变量的声明

public class Test01{
	public static void main(String[] args){
		//声明变量
		int num;byte num01;
		short num02;long num03;
		float num04;double num05;
		boolean num06=true;//flase
		char num07='a';
		//初始化变量
		num=20;
		num01=20;
		num02=20;
		num03=20;
		num04=20;
		num05=20;
	//打印输出变量的值
	System.out.println(num+" "+num01+" "
	+num02+" "+num03+" "
	+num04+" "+num05+" "
	+num06+" "+num07);	
        num=10;
		num01=10;
		num02=10;
		num03=10;
		num04=10;
		num05=10;
	    num06=false;
		num07='A';
		System.out.println(num+" "+num01+" "
	+num02+" "+num03+" "
	+num04+" "+num05+" "
	+num06+" "+num07);
	}
}

 

  •  在同一个代码段(main方法中)中不能存在同名变量
  • 程序运行期间其值可以发生改变

六、数据类型

 6.1基本数据类型

      基本数据类型包括:数值型(short  int  long  float double ),字符型(char),布尔(boolean)

 6.1.2 引用数据类型

      类(class)、数组、接口(interface)

 6.2数据赋值

 6.3类型转换

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值